Here are list of cities and towns in Cape Verde. In Cape Verde, the urban settlements have different names accordingly to their importance. The settlements of bigger importance (generally the more populated ones) are called “cities”. The settlements of relative importance (for instance, all the municipalities seats) are called “towns”. The settlements of lesser importance are called “villages”.
[edit] Cities
The majority of the population live in Praia or the island of Santiago which is 264,066 (January 1, 2005) which is home to 55% of the archipelago of Cape Verde.
